Research And Application Of 3D Real Scene Modeling And Visualization Technology Based On Multi-Source Data Fusion

The battlefield environment is the key factor affecting the direction of the war.The terrain is the main component of the battlefield environment.With the changes in military technology;,precision strikes,and the use of precision dagger weapons,the limitations of traditional two-dimensional maps have been unable to meet the needs of military training and military command.For the current 3D battlefield shape,the requirements for rapid terrain model construction,terrain model refinement,and mass data visualization are becoming more and more high.Therefore,this paper has carried out in-depth research to construct a real three-dimensional battlefield geographic environment and visualization.In this paper,the oblique photography technology and Cesium visualization library are used to establish the real three-dimensional terrain and the construction of the visualization platform.The Weiyang Campus of Xi'an University of Technology is used as a typical application example for urban combat visualization development.Firstly,this paper introduces the theory of 3D real-world modeling and visualization;discusses the advantages of visual development on the Web;and puts forward the problems and solutions to the 3D battlefield construction.Secondly,this paper has developed a multi-source data acquisition scheme for battlefield environment and a modeling process based on Smart3D multi-source data fusion.The 3D battlefield shape data was produced and the model quality analysis was carried out,including the texture accuracy,geometric precision and geographic coordinate precision of the model.Ensure that the generated interventions on the ground personnel.Finally,based on the first three chapters,this paper adopts the B\S three-tier architecture to construct the battlefield environment visualization platform through Cesium,HTLM,JavaScript and other languages,and realizes the three-dimensional battlefield environment construction of urbanization operations.At the same time,this paper completes the functions of model singularization and model driving based on Cesium.This topic is of great significance to the construction and visualization of 3D battlefield environment.The battlefield environment construction method proposed in this paper can be applied to the construction of various battlefield environments,including the construction of combat terrain environment in mountainous hills and urban anti-terrorism operations.Through the loading of the visualization platform,you can intuitively and truly understand the battlefield environment.Model-driven completion of various demonstration effects in the battlefield.
